Housing Assistance Tools
This particular fact sheet presents a synopsis of general general public programs that will provide help with renovating and weatherizing housing that is existing filling power needs and getting access to public housing and lease assistance. Because programs and capital sources change rapidly, interested individuals should seek the advice of their city that is local or housing authority (if any), aided by the local Rural and Economic Development workplace, along with the regional social solutions or individual solutions division for present information.
RURAL AND ECONOMIC DEVELOPING LOANS
Rural and development that is economicSection 502″ loans can be obtained to rehabilitate houses that are not able to satisfy minimal requirements for „decent, safe and sanitary“ housing, also to make domiciles available to people with disabilities. Contact the Rural that is local and developing workplace, that will be generally found during the county chair.
DO IT YOURSELF LOAN PROGRAM
The Wisconsin Housing and Economic Development Authority (WHEDA) administers the true home Improvement Loan Program (HILP) while the Residence Energy Loan Program (HELP). These programs are created to enable property owners with low or moderate incomes to fix and boost their domiciles. This program makes FHA-insured house enhancement loans offered by mortgage loan underneath the market price. A 3rd system, the house Energy Incentive Program, is employed with HILP for energy preservation jobs. To try to get that loan, visit a participating financing organization, or call 800-334-6873.
LOW-INCOME ENERGY ASSISTANCE SYSTEM
The Low-Income Energy Assistance Program provides power help for low-income tenants and property owners. Eligibility is restricted to households which have earnings perhaps not more than 150% associated with the poverty degree, and that demonstrate an „energy burden“. This implies family members must pay a fuel directly provider or pay rent that features temperature. Applications frequently needs to be made through the county Energy Assistance workplace. Re re Payments were created centered on a multi-tier routine depending on earnings, home size, and gas kind. One re payment in the appropriate benefit rate is good for the whole heating period.
WEATHERIZATION PROGRAMS
In many counties, free weatherization can be acquired for qualified low-income customers through fuel and electric resources. Contractors are employed to put in insulation, along with to caulk and weather strip. Phone the utility that is local more information.
LEASE ASSISTANCE FOR PUBLIC HOUSING
General general Public housing programs offer publicly-owned and publicly-operated housing for low-income families and solitary people that are age 62 or older, have impairment, or are displaced by federal federal government action or catastrophe. Regional housing authorities set earnings restrictions, and lease may perhaps perhaps not surpass 30% of earnings. Contact the city that is local county housing authority for information.
SECTION 8 HOUSING SUBSIDIES
The federal Department of Housing and Urban developing (HUD) contracts, either directly or by way of a housing that is local, with owners of brand new, existing or rehabilitated housing devices. HUD pays the difference between lease charged from the market that is private the tenant’s share, which can be centered on earnings. The participating owners can be private or public. Flats, homes and rented homes that are mobile meet the requirements. Another type of Section 8 program offers a rent subsidy certificate to a qualified applicant who then discovers a landlord who’s prepared to engage. It is sometimes feasible to acquire a subsidy for the tenant’s present dwelling. Contact the housing that is local for details.
RURAL LEASE ASSISTANCE
In rural areas, the Rural and Economic Development workplace administers a rent support system much like the part 8 program. The program that is rural the exact same earnings directions to ascertain eligibility. The lease charged to the tenant is usually limited by 30% associated with tenant’s earnings. Priority is directed at tenants in program-sponsored jobs that are spending the greatest portion of the income toward lease. Contact the local Rural and Economic developing workplace for details.
